Perseus:bib:oclc, 559481156. The Dīvān .Translated for the first time out of the Persian into English prose, with critical and explanatory remarks, with an introductory preface, with a note on Ṣūfīism, and with a life of the author, by H. Wilberforce Clarke. Calcutta, India. 1891.

  1. Friends ! repentance of veiledness, the daughter of the vine (love)^ made : ### To the Muhtasib (reason, love's forbidder) she went; and by (God's) permission the work (of loosening the knot from the feet of holy travellers) made. ***
